Nasi Goreng, or Indonesian fried rice, is a popular dish that is enjoyed throughout Indonesia and Southeast Asia. Made with a variety of flavorful ingredients, including soy sauce, shrimp paste, and chili paste, this dish is a delicious and easy-to-make option for any meal of the day. Ingredients:

  • 2 cups of cooked rice, preferably day-old
  • 2 tablespoons of vegetable oil
  • 1 small onion, diced
  • 2 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 2 eggs, beaten
  • 1/2 cup of cooked shrimp, chopped
  • 1/2 cup of cooked chicken,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on of so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on of shrimp paste
  • 1 tablespoon of chili paste
  • 1 teaspoon of sugar
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Sliced green onions and lime wedges for garnish

Instructions:

  1. Heat the vegetable oil in a large frying pan over medium heat.
  2. Add the diced onion and minced garlic to the pan and sauté until fragrant and softened.
  3. Add the beaten eggs to the pan and scramble until cooked.
  4. Add the cooked shrimp and chicken to the pan and stir until heated through.
  5. Add the cooked rice to the pan and stir until the rice is heated and coated with the ingredients.
  6. In a small bowl, mix together the soy sauce, shrimp paste, chili paste, sugar, salt, and pepper. Add this mixture to the pan and stir to combine.
  7. Cook the rice and ingredients for another 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  8. Serve hot, garnished with sliced green onions and lime wedges.
